What carbs were installed on the European 914's at the factory?
Mike Bellis
All 914-4's were fuel injected.
SirAndy
QUOTE(kg6dxn @ Nov 26 2011, 01:57 PM) *
All 914-4's were fuel injected.

Nope. The euro 1.8L cars came with carbs.
shades.gif

If i'm not mistaken, they had two single barrel webers in a similar setup as the VW 411.

http://www.914world.com/specs/engnumbs.php
Tom_T
I thought they were the 2 barrel Webers used on the 1960's 912s, but I could be mistaken.
Maybe a Euro 1.8 owner could speak up on that.

BTW - that was only the 74 & 75 MY 914-1.8s in European market & maybe some went to Asia or South America too.
Jake Raby
Single barrel solexes...
MikeSpraggi
QUOTE(Jake Raby @ Nov 26 2011, 06:35 PM) *

Single barrel solexes...


agree.gif Absolutely Solex's.

dlestep
32-PDSIT-2, -3 on Type 3s...dual port head
34-PDSIT-2, -3 on Type 4s (boxers) 411- 412
different type of single throat Solexes on Bus
and upright configurations...I forget the type designation.
bdstone914
PET program says single barrle Solex PDSIT carbs.
